The size of Carrara is approximately 13.8 square kilometres. It has 19 parks covering nearly 26.3% of total area. The population of Carrara in 2016 was 12060 people. By 2021 the population was 13138 showing a population growth of 8.9%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Carrara is 40-49 years. Households in Carrara are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Carrara work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 70.20% of the homes in Carrara were owner-occupied compared with 67.60% in 2016.
